The Public Private Partnership of Dane County will be hosting a FREE workshop on Cyber Security on Wednesday September 26, 2012 from 1-4:00 pm at Madison College - West Campus (302 S. Gammon Rd., Madison, WI 53717). This workshop is designed to provide an non-technical awareness of cybersecurity issues and provide you with information you can use to develop a cybersecurity strategy for your organization.

The purpose of the workshop will be to orient non-IT people to cyber security issues. After attending the workshop, you will be able to identify the different types of cyber threats your organization is vulnerable to, understand the functionality of protective measures from both the technical and user perspectives, and understand some of your legal responsibilities when maintaining personnel information.

Topics of discussion include:
• ?nIdentifying relationships between user habits and cyber threats.
• ?nUsing organizational policy to protect against cyber attacks.
• ?nLegal responsibilities for protecting personally identifiable information.

The Partnership understands your time is at a premium, so the workshops are designed to be concise and informative. The Partnership’s goal is to provide you with information that will give you a basic foundation for developing strategies and connect you with a network of professionals that can work with you to build on that foundation.
